For large-scale outdoor algal cultures productivities of 30–40 g dry weight m-2. day-1 seem to represent the present achievable limit over sustained periods. Over shorter periods, and in smaller culture systems productivities as high as 60 g dry weight.m-2.day-1 have been recorded for Dunaliella. In D. salina the optimum salinity for growth lies between 18 and 22% NaCl whereas the optimum salinity for carotenoid production is >27% NaCl .
Lower salinities generally favour the growth of the non-carotenogenic Dunaliella species, D. viridis, D. minuta and D. parva .
